Output feeb3cea303a9b51a018876e4f70d2a1561d880fbc454055b7b22ff11a2dbbb6:2

value
610657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11068b9f7995774a0a3428eaa2e08aea17e9fa07 OP_EQUAL
address
33F3Fb2DUxMsr7ymriipUyTeqsvYBJJj5b
transaction
feeb3cea303a9b51a018876e4f70d2a1561d880fbc454055b7b22ff11a2dbbb6
spent
true